如何安装 Hexo

Hexo Logo

首先,我们需要 Git 和 Nodejs

Git 的安装就不演示了,相信大家使用 hexo 的都会安装 git 了。

下面是 Nodejs 的安装

到 nodejs 官网下载 nodejs

下载左边的和右边的均可,这里以右边的为例:

nodejs download

接着,我们按照正常的方法安装 nodejs。

安装完成后,在命令行里输入 node -v 查看 node 版本,出现版本号则安装成功,如下图所示:

nodejs version

npm -v 查看 npm 版本:

npm version

好,我们已经安装完成了 nodejs。

接下来,我们安装 hexo。在命令行中输入 npm install hexo-cli -g

我们来看看这条命令的意思:
npm 是最基础的开头部分,install 是安装命令,hexo-cli 是我们要安装的包的名字,而 -g 则代表全局安装,也就是说你在哪里都可以使用前面安装的包。了解你输入的命令非常重要,这样你以后就有机会在 TravisCI 上测试部署了。

点击回车之后,我们看到命令行输出了一堆奇怪的字符,先不要管他,看到这些提示说明你安装成功了:

install hexo

下一步,创建一个新的文件夹,并安装 hexo

我们创建一个新的文件夹,名字随意。

create folder

在上一级文件夹中,输入 hexo init <你的文件夹名字> 来初始化这个文件夹:

hexo initial

好,现在让我们进入该文件夹,运行 npm install 来安装一些依赖的包文件:

npm install

然后运行 hexo generate 或者 hexo g(这两个命令其实是一样的)来初始化 hexo:

hexo generate

接着,输入 hexo serverhexo s(这两条命令也是一样的)来在本地运行 hexo:

hexo server

现在,打开你的浏览器,在地址栏输入 localhost:4000 回车后进入网页

browser

好了,我们已经成功的安装了 hexo

恭喜,我们安装成功了

恭喜!

一些使用 hexo 的常见命令

结果 Hexo 命令
创建新的草稿 hexo new draft <name>
发布已经创建的草稿 hexo publish <name>
创建新页面 hexo new page <name>
生成网站文件 hexo generatehexo g
开启网站服务器 hexo serverhexo s